73 * Per-parser-generator configuration. These values are used to cheat and
74 * directly access the bison/yacc token name table (yyname or yytname).
75 * Note: These values are the index in yyname for the first lex token
76 * (PARSEOP_ACCCESSAS).
79 #define ASL_YYTNAME_START 3 /* Bison */
80 #elif defined (YYBYACC)
81 #define ASL_YYTNAME_START 257 /* Berkeley yacc */

96 /* Internal AML opcodes */
98 #define AML_RAW_DATA_BYTE (UINT16) 0xAA01 /* write one raw byte */
99 #define AML_RAW_DATA_WORD (UINT16) 0xAA02 /* write 2 raw bytes */
100 #define AML_RAW_DATA_DWORD (UINT16) 0xAA04 /* write 4 raw bytes */
101 #define AML_RAW_DATA_QWORD (UINT16) 0xAA08 /* write 8 raw bytes */
102 #define AML_RAW_DATA_BUFFER (UINT16) 0xAA0B /* raw buffer with length */
103 #define AML_RAW_DATA_CHAIN (UINT16) 0xAA0C /* chain of raw buffers */
104 #define AML_PACKAGE_LENGTH (UINT16) 0xAA10
105 #define AML_UNASSIGNED_OPCODE (UINT16) 0xEEEE
106 #define AML_DEFAULT_ARG_OP (UINT16) 0xDDDD
